Cosmetics under the Christmas tree!

Beauty products are a must-have during the holiday season. According to a study conducted by the American firm The Benchmarking Company, 96% of women have given a beauty or skincare product to a loved one.

The survey was conducted in November 2025 among more than 3,300 American women.

Who do consumers give beauty products to?

Cosmetics are mainly intended for close friends and family. Respondents said they primarily give these gifts to:
• Friends (72%)
• Family members (70%)
• Their spouse or partner (66%)
• Their children (52%)
• Colleagues (30%)

While holidays remain the primary trigger for purchases (85%), other occasions are becoming more common. Birthdays account for 82% of respondents, but nearly one in two also mention purchases “for no particular reason” (48%) or to show appreciation (43%).

When beauty becomes the gift of choice

The report highlights a very personal connection to beauty gifts. Consumers explain their choices by:
• Buying products they would like to receive themselves (63%)
• The feeling of well-being and care associated with these products (61%)
• The belief that everyone likes cosmetics (61%)
• Rhe practical and enjoyable nature of these gifts (59%)
